计算机研发和编程什么区别
-
计算机研发和编程是计算机领域中两个不同的概念,虽然它们之间有一定的联系,但在实际应用中有着明显的区别。
首先,计算机研发是指对计算机硬件和软件进行全面的研究和开发。它涉及到计算机系统的设计、构建和优化等方面。计算机研发的主要目标是提高计算机的性能、可靠性和功能。在计算机研发过程中,研究人员需要对计算机的体系结构、电路设计、操作系统、数据库等方面进行深入的研究和开发,以满足不断变化的市场需求。
而编程则是计算机研发过程中的一部分,它是将算法和逻辑转化为计算机可执行的代码的过程。编程主要包括选择合适的编程语言、编写代码、调试和优化等步骤。编程的目的是根据需求开发出具有特定功能的软件应用程序或系统。编程可以分为低级编程和高级编程两种形式,低级编程主要涉及底层的硬件控制和操作系统编程,而高级编程则更加关注算法和逻辑的实现。
总结来说,计算机研发和编程是计算机领域中两个不同的概念。计算机研发主要关注计算机系统的设计和开发,而编程则是将算法和逻辑转化为计算机可执行的代码的过程。两者相辅相成,在计算机研发过程中,编程是实现研究成果的重要手段。
1年前 -
计算机研发和编程是计算机科学领域中的两个相关但不完全相同的概念。虽然它们都与计算机技术和软件开发有关,但在实际中存在一些明显的区别。以下是计算机研发和编程之间的五个区别:
-
目标和方法:计算机研发的主要目标是创新和开发新的计算机技术和解决方案。这包括研究和开发新的算法、技术和系统,以满足不断变化的需求。而编程是实现这些技术和解决方案的具体过程,它是一种将思想转化为代码的技术。
-
范围和深度:计算机研发涉及更广泛和更深入的领域。它涵盖了计算机体系结构、操作系统、网络、数据库、人工智能等多个领域的研究和开发。编程则更专注于实现具体的功能和解决具体的问题,涉及更具体的编程语言和工具。
-
技能和知识要求:计算机研发需要更深入的理论知识和技术背景。研发人员需要具备扎实的数学、算法和计算机科学基础知识,以及良好的问题解决和创新能力。编程则更注重实际的编程技能和经验,需要熟悉特定的编程语言和开发工具。
-
时间和资源投入:计算机研发通常需要更长的时间和更多的资源。研发新的技术和解决方案需要进行深入的研究、实验和测试,可能需要多个阶段和多个团队的合作。而编程则是在研发的基础上进行实际的编码工作,相对来说更加迅速和直接。
-
创新和应用:计算机研发注重创新和前沿技术的发展。研发人员致力于寻找新的解决方案和技术,推动计算机科学的进步。编程则更注重实际的应用和解决问题。编程人员的主要任务是根据需求实现具体的功能和系统,使其能够满足用户的需求。
综上所述,计算机研发和编程虽然有一些相似之处,但在目标、方法、范围、深度、技能和知识要求、时间和资源投入以及创新和应用等方面存在明显的区别。理解这些区别有助于更好地了解计算机科学领域中不同角色的职责和要求。
1年前 -
-
计算机研发和编程是计算机领域中两个不同的概念。计算机研发主要涉及硬件和软件的开发和创新,而编程则是实现软件功能的具体操作。下面将从方法、操作流程等方面详细介绍计算机研发和编程的区别。
一、计算机研发
计算机研发主要是指对计算机硬件和软件的研究、开发和创新。它包括以下几个方面的工作:-
硬件研发:硬件研发主要是指对计算机硬件的研究和开发,如芯片设计、电路板设计、硬件组装等。硬件研发需要掌握相关的工程知识和技术,如电子工程、电路设计、信号处理等。
-
软件研发:软件研发主要是指对计算机软件的研究和开发,如操作系统、数据库管理系统、应用软件等。软件研发需要掌握相关的编程语言和开发工具,如C++、Java、Python等。
-
创新研究:创新研究是计算机研发的核心内容,它涉及到对计算机技术的前沿研究和创新。例如,人工智能、机器学习、物联网等领域的研究和创新都属于计算机研发的范畴。
计算机研发的过程一般包括以下几个步骤:
-
需求分析:根据用户的需求和功能要求,对计算机系统进行需求分析,明确研发目标和方向。
-
设计阶段:根据需求分析的结果,进行系统设计和算法设计,确定硬件和软件的架构和功能。
-
开发阶段:根据设计阶段的结果,进行系统的开发和实现,包括硬件的制造和软件的编程。
-
测试阶段:对研发的系统进行测试,包括功能测试、性能测试和安全测试等,确保系统的稳定性和可靠性。
-
部署和维护:将研发完成的系统部署到实际环境中,并进行系统的维护和更新。
二、编程
编程是计算机研发过程中的一部分,它主要是指根据需求和设计,使用特定的编程语言和开发工具,将算法和逻辑转化为计算机能够理解和执行的指令。编程的过程一般包括以下几个步骤:
-
程序设计:根据需求和设计,进行程序的设计,包括确定程序的输入和输出、数据结构和算法等。
-
编码阶段:根据程序设计的结果,使用特定的编程语言和开发工具进行编码,将设计的程序转化为计算机能够执行的指令。
-
调试和测试:对编码完成的程序进行调试和测试,确保程序的正确性和稳定性。
-
优化和改进:根据测试结果和用户反馈,对程序进行优化和改进,提高程序的性能和用户体验。
编程是计算机研发过程中的重要环节,它需要掌握良好的编程技巧和逻辑思维能力,能够将复杂的问题分解为简单的步骤,并通过编程语言实现。
总结:
计算机研发和编程是计算机领域中两个不同的概念。计算机研发主要涉及硬件和软件的开发和创新,包括硬件研发、软件研发和创新研究等方面。编程则是实现软件功能的具体操作,它是计算机研发过程中的一部分,需要根据需求和设计使用特定的编程语言和开发工具进行编码。计算机研发和编程相辅相成,共同推动了计算机技术的发展和创新。1年前 -